March 25, 1958~July 10, 2021

David Thomas Muetzel, 63, of New Port Richey, Florida, passed away peacefully in his sleep on July 10, 2021.

David was a beloved and fiercely devoted husband, father, uncle, brother, son, and the world’s greatest Papa.  Born in Cleveland, Ohio, David was happiest near the ocean with his family, which brought them to New Port Richey 22 years ago.  He spent his life in service of others.  He was a hard-working man and never hesitated in helping others.  David worked as a truck driver, and he spent many years driving over-the-road, seeing and appreciating the beauty of this country.  Throughout his career, he traveled through every state in the contiguous United States and into Canada.  In addition to raising his two children, he was a foster dad to many through the years.  David was dedicated to his family, loved being outdoors at the beach or on a boat, and knew how to fix everything.  He had the biggest heart and a one-of-a-kind sense of humor.  He illuminated the rooms he walked through, and his laughter filled the hearts of the people who loved him.

He is survived by his devoted wife of 40 years, LaWanna; his son, Brandon; his daughter, Brittany, and her husband Sam; his grandson, Finley David, who adored his Papa; 15 nieces and nephews; seven great-nieces and nephews; and a large extended family, all who loved him dearly.

Hearts are broken and he will be missed.

A celebration of David’s life and memory will be held for family and friends at Crescent Oaks Country Club (3300 Crescent Oaks Blvd, Tarpon Springs, FL 34688) on July 24, 2021, at 11:00am.
